Output 1abfadb6201753c8d2531409ca5a5ca436aece1a25a1462adaf7de752f04f01e:1

value
526515
script pubkey
OP_0 OP_PUSHBYTES_20 c03a29d5ab27b80a60ee9772a090d6968b13cc4b
address
bc1qcqazn4dty7uq5c8wjae2pyxkj6938nzt3rvdyf
transaction
1abfadb6201753c8d2531409ca5a5ca436aece1a25a1462adaf7de752f04f01e
spent
true